I have the SOHC 1.6L motor(stock) with a T3/T4 turbo with intercooler.
It was tuned using Hondata.
I'm running 13 PSI and am getting close to 240 FWHP.

I ran a 14.2 on street tires and 13.8 on drag radials with LSD also.

Welcome aboard, you'll find there are a number of us here who used to do the Honda thing (myself included).

SOHC 1.6... D16Z6?

MS is short for MegaSquirt, it's become the management of choice, especially around here. Think of it like chrome or uberdata, in that it's opensource.
